Get fiddler working with python requests module

Get fiddlers base64 encoded root certificate

  1. Install fiddler winget install -e --id Telerik.Fiddler
  2. Open fiddler and go to Tools -> Options -> HTTPS
  3. Enable Decrypt HTTPS traffic
  4. Click the Actions button and select Export root certificate to desktop
  5. Right click the FiddlerRoot.cer file on the desktop and click Open with -> Crypto Shell Extensions
  6. In the Certificate window that opens up go to Details -> Copy to File
  7. Click Next then select Base-64 encoded X.509 (.CER) then specify the file name (E.G. FiddlerRootBase64.cer)
  8. Click Next to create the new file

Best practices for presto sql

Presto Specific

  • Don’t SELECT *, Specify explicit column names (columnar store)
  • Avoid large JOINs (filter each table first)
    • In PRESTO tables are joined in the order they are listed!!
    • Join small tables earlier in the plan and leave larger fact tables to the end
    • Avoid cross joins or 1 to many joins as these can degrade performance
  • Order by and group by take time
    • only use order by in subqueries if it is really necessary
  • When using GROUP BY, order the columns by the highest cardinality (that is, most number of unique values) to the lowest.
